NEPSE loses 63.28 points to close at 2,905 points



KATHMANDU: There was a landslide in the stock market on the first trading day of the week Sunday. The Nepal Stock Exchange (NEPSE) index dropped by 63.28 points to close at 2,905 points, a massive fall from the high 3,000 points it journeyed last week.

The share price of most trading companies declined and all the market group sub-indices have turned red.

Though the index saw a landslide, the transaction amount swelled nearly by a billion to Rs 12 billion from less than Rs 11 billion on the last trading day Thursday of last week.

A total of 273,444,500 shares of 230 companies traded through 128,281 transactions Sunday.

Shares of very few companies rose and bonds were on the rise, while finance and development bank groups lost the most.
